KUALA LUMPUR: Titan Chemicals Corp Bhd's share price surged in early trade on Monday, July 19 after South Korea's Honam Petrochemical Corp launched a takeover of Titan, to acquire the remaining 72.32% stake or 1.249 billion shares for RM2.93 billion or RM2.35 a share.
At 9.18am, Titan jumped 34 sen to RM2.19 with 18.2 million shares done.Its major shareholders Union Harvard Investments S.R.L, CGDC Investments Corporation, Permodalan Nasional Bhd and AmanahRaya Trustees Bhd had signed agreements to sell their collective stakes to Honam.

#Flash* Korea's Honam Petrochemical launches RM2.93b takeover of Titan Chemicals
KUALA LUMPUR: South Korea's Honam Petrochemical Corp has launched a takeover of Titan Chemicals Corp. Bhd., to acquire remaining 72.32% stake or 1.249 billion shares for RM2.93b or RM2.35 a share.
Titan said on Friday, July 16 that its major shareholders Union Harvard Investments S.R.L, CGDC Investments Corporation, Permodalan Nasional Bhd, and AmanahRaya Trustees Bhd had signed agreements to sell their collective stakes to Honam.
